The quintessential village pub.

Savour proper real ales and award-winning traditional dishes at our centuries-old inn in the heart of Bretforton, on the edge of the Cotswolds.

Settle into the cosy pub with its low beams, three roaring fires, and a heritage interior that tells stories of times gone by.

Prefer the open air? Soak up the peace of the courtyard or tuck into one of our heated horse boxes in the orchard, surrounded by apple trees and birdsong.

If you are planning to eat we recommend booking a table, especially during busy times. Open-air orchard seating is unreserved: first come, first served.

Awards Include:

Best Country Pub 2025 in the Great British Pub Awards 

Worcestershire CAMRA County Pub of the Year 2025

Shakespeare (Worcestershire) CAMRA Pub of the Year 2025, 2024, 2022, 2020 and 2018.
Good Pub Guide Top Ten Country Pubs

Best Beer Gardens in the Cotswolds Winner 2023 & 2024
Daily Telegraph / Sawdays Pub of the Year 2019
Visit Worcestershire Pub of the Year
World Record Holder for Nigel Night!
